Broadcasting service is a valuable servant of national unity: Sajida

The First Lady, Madam Sajida Mohamed, has stated that the broadcasting service of the Maldives is a valuable servant of national unity that connected islands scattered in the shadows of tall waves of a vast ocean. She said this in her speech while gracing the award ceremony of the “Visions of the Future” drawing competition held today at the National Art Gallery.

Shedding light on the service of the broadcasting field, she said that it is important to teach students about the importance of the broadcasting field and to create interest in that area. She noted that through activities like this drawing competition organized by the Broadcasting Commission, it can help in building students’ careers. Additionally, she highlighted the importance of newer generations understanding the role that TV and radio play on a national level.

The First Lady presented the most prestigious awards at today’s ceremony. After presenting the awards, there was also a special photo session. She also viewed the “Visions of the Future” drawings at this ceremony.
